Lonesome Goatherd Blues. Y’all don’t sleep on the new Jonny Miles book, pictured here perched on a goat skull. Our hero lies about his qualifications, pads his resume, and ends up alone and unprepared on a tiny island with the job of restoring ecological balance by eradicating invasive goats. This book stays well out of the ditches, avoids cliche at every turn, and sets up a fable in which the very idea that things “should be” one way or another is called into question.
Consider: “Adi wandered through this damp gnarled sanctuary as through a dream not his own—a dinosaur’s dream, or an orchid’s, or the deathbed memory of a shriveled island summoning its glistening green prime.”

Coming January 6th, 2026! COURAGE to WRITE grantee Max Watman's novel, TOMORROW, THE WAR will be published by Heresy Press.
This is especially exciting, as it is the project for which Max was awarded a grant!
TOMORROW, THE WAR is a sweeping historical epic that follows the intertwined lives of Jed Stokes, a restless wanderer shaped by violence, and Raleigh, a once-enslaved man seeking justice. Perfect for fans of historical fiction, TOMORROW, THE WAR is a gripping tale of survival, rebellion, chutzpah, and redemption.
